1. Start with the exact geography your firm will accept
Rumson is a municipality in Monmouth County, New Jersey. The 2020–2024 American Community Survey 5-year population estimate for Rumson borough is 7,241, with a margin of error of 20. That is location context, not evidence of search demand or legal-service demand. It also does not establish that a campaign should target only Rumson. Your actual service area may be narrower or broader, depending on the practice area, court coverage, consultation policy, and willingness to handle inquiries from elsewhere in Monmouth County or New Jersey. The useful planning question is therefore not “How large is Rumson?” but “Which locations and case types should receive a paid inquiry?”
Recommended approach
Bring a written service-area boundary to the consultation. Separate Rumson from Monmouth County and from any wider New Jersey coverage. Identify locations you accept, locations you exclude, and the geographic exceptions that require attorney review before an intake is treated as qualified.
